The Rise of Web-Based Arcade Games
Historically, arcade games captured the imaginations of players through dedicated machines featuring simple, yet addictive gameplay. However, the advent of high-speed internet and HTML5 technology has precipitated a renaissance in digital arcade experiences accessible directly through web browsers. This shift has been underpinned by several industry insights:
- Accessibility & Convenience: Players no longer need specialized hardware; a standard device suffices.
- Cost-Effectiveness: Developers and publishers can reach a global audience with minimal distribution costs.
- Increased Engagement: Instant playability and social sharing features foster higher user engagement.
Innovative Gameplay and Monetisation Strategies
Modern web-based arcade games incorporate sophisticated graphics and mechanics, often blending nostalgia with contemporary design principles. For instance, many titles emulate classic gameplay styles but introduce new features such as social leaderboards, multilevel challenges, and in-game purchases. These advancements have redefined monetisation strategies within this niche, notably:
- Freemium Models: Offering free gameplay with optional upgrades or cosmetic items.
- Ad Integration: Incorporating rewarded ads that do not interrupt user experience.
- Subscription Services: Providing ad-free access and exclusive content for recurring payments.

Spotlight on User Engagement and Gaming Communities
The social aspect remains central to the enduring appeal of arcade games. Leaderboards, multiplayer modes, and live events foster community bonds and competitive spirit among players. This engagement is amplified via social media integration, sharing functionalities, and community-driven content creation. Many developers focus on optimizing their online games to leverage these dynamics, ensuring longevity and regular user interaction.
For example, some platforms encourage players to recreate or modify classic titles via accessible development tools, thereby nurturing a vibrant ecosystem of user-generated content.

Industry Outlook and Future Challenges
As the sector matures, key challenges include maintaining user retention, balancing monetisation without detracting from user experience, and ensuring cross-platform compatibility. Data-driven insights suggest that personalization and adaptive difficulty levels will play vital roles in keeping players invested.
Furthermore, regulatory considerations, including data privacy and fair monetisation, require ongoing assessment to align with evolving legal frameworks.
